Update.
authordrepper <drepper>
Wed, 4 Mar 1998 09:53:17 +0000 (09:53 +0000)
committerdrepper <drepper>
Wed, 4 Mar 1998 09:53:17 +0000 (09:53 +0000)
ChangeLog

index 0c6a452..c250d07 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,4 +1,18 @@
-Wed Mar  4 11:32:01 1998  Andreas Schwab  <schwab@issan.informatik.uni-dortmund.de>
+1998-03-04 09:43  Ulrich Drepper  <drepper@cygnus.com>
+
+       * elf/link.h (struct link_map): Add new field l_reloc_result.
+       * elf/dl-reloc.c (_dl_relocate_object): Allocate array for results
+       of relocation for the object to be profiled.
+       * elf/dl-object.c (_dl_new_object): Initialize l_reloc_result field
+       to NULL.
+       * elf/rtld.c (_dl_start): Add comment that we must not allocate an
+       array here.
+       * elf/dl-runtime.c (profile_fixup): If l_reloc_result array already
+       contains a result from a previous run use this instead of computing
+       the value again.
+       * elf/dl-minimal.c (malloc): Remove limit for size of allocation.
+
+1998-03-04 11:32  Andreas Schwab  <schwab@issan.informatik.uni-dortmund.de>
 
        * sysdeps/m68k/dl-machine.h: (elf_machine_load_address): Use word
        offsets into the GOT.